1. Affordability Meets Growth Potential

Detroit continues to be one of the most affordable major real estate markets in the U.S. For investors, that combination of low purchase prices with strong upside makes it a standout.

Why affordability matters:

  • Lower entry point: You can buy a property for significantly less than in many other big cities.
  • Easier to turn a profit: With lower acquisition costs, rental income or resale can offer stronger margins.
  • Shorter path to cash flow: Investors often reach positive cash flow more quickly, especially when working with a knowledgeable real estate agent.

3. Attractive Rental Market Dynamics

High rent-to-purchase ratios make Detroit an appealing city for buy-and-hold investors focused on rental income. Here’s how the numbers stack up in your favor:

  1. Strong rental demand: Students, young professionals, and families all need affordable rentals in revitalizing districts.
  2. High yields: Lower purchase prices combined with steady rents give you returns that outpace many other U.S. metros.
  3. Scalability: With lower costs, investors can acquire multiple units or properties, diversifying their portfolio quickly.

Practical Investment Tips for Detroit Property Buyers
  • Define your strategy: Are you focused on flipping, buy-and-hold, or niche redevelopment? That shapes your search for property listings.
  • Use multiple search tools: Combine Zillow-style platforms, MLS searches, and direct realtor communications for a full view.
  • Understand true costs: Include renovation, taxes, insurance, and vacancy periods when projecting returns.
  • Build a local support team: A reliable real estate agent, knowing the Detroit rehab market, plus trusted local contractors, are invaluable.
  • Monitor market data: Keep tabs on average days on market, neighborhood sales trends, and rent levels to spot shifts early.
